Bar manifolds
Brass bar manifolds are extremely resistant to mechanical stress and corrosion and can be used in both heating and cooling systems.
They are available in different configurations, with various numbers of outlets and diameters, to suit a wide range of system requirements.
Available in yellow brass and nickel-plated brass.

Description
Brass-bar manifolds are availble in yellow and nickel-plated brass, in a complete series of sizes, from 2 to 12 ways.
Brass-bar manifolds are suitable for the realization of heating and sanitary installations. Manifolds configuration permits the realization of hot and/or cold circuits in parallel. They have center distance of 55mm. 6200.G9/6200.G9.N have holes on both sides.
Different accessories, such as air vent valves, charge/discharge valves, ball valves, allow to complete the manifold with all the necessary components for the correct operation of the system.

Benefits
- Suitable both for high and low temperature installations
- Raw materials complying with UBA LIST
- Suitable wiht plastic, metal and metal-plastic pipes.
- Suitable both for heating and cooling installations
Applications
-
T. min.
- -20°C
-
T. max / metal pipes
- +120°C
-
T. max / metal-plastic pipes
- +95°C
-
Max. pressure
- 10 bar
-20°C: only with antifreeze liquid (glycol) in % max of 30%
